What event directors in fact need from sanitation

Most supervisors do not want to come to be washroom specialists. They want reliable recommendations, a clear plan, and a supplier that can adapt. After years of supporting young people soccer weekends, traveling baseball events, and local softball qualifiers, a couple of requirements show up consistently.

The initially is capability that matches human behavior, not just headcount. Family members get here early, commonly with siblings, and they gather around particular areas. More youthful teams take even more bathroom breaks than varsity squads. Ladies braces typically need extra devices per group than young boys braces due to the fact that time at the mirror and handwashing include mins to the regular check out. If an event offers beer or seltzers in a fenced friendliness location, use spikes contrasted to a completely dry event, especially late in the day. A rough policy like one unit per 75 people just holds if you factor in check out frequency and duration.

The second is thoughtful placement. A map that looks neat on Thursday can trigger lengthy lines on Saturday if devices wind up also much from giving ins or as well near a hectic pathway. Individuals choose short, straight routes that feel risk-free and noticeable. Units put behind a storage shed may be criminal damage risks and will get less interest from volunteers. Units completely sunlight will certainly heat rapidly and utilize paper much faster. Wind defense can matter as much as distance. On https://chancerqrk098.tearosediner.net/just-how-to-choose-the-right-portable-toilet-setup-for-outdoor-occasions-with-linkon-logs-portable-restroom-rental a breezy Nebraska afternoon, also a well-leveled device can feel unsteady unless it is anchored and shielded.

The third is trusted solution. For single-day events that finish prior to sunset, a pre-event pump and post-event pick-up may be enough. Multi-day events normally require at least one mid-event solution to reset chemical therapies, replenish paper, and mop insides. When temperatures push past 85 levels, or when squads play through rain and mud, including a second service can keep odors and tracking under control. A light touch here repays, because cleaner systems lead individuals to act far better. Muddy floors breed muddy traffic.

Translating head counts into a working plan

Tournament math is specific, not common. Still, there are general rules that help a director or center supervisor enter the best ball park before a site walk.

  • Plan roughly one typical mobile toilet per 50 to 75 guests on site at peak, with the lower proportion for occasions with alcohol or hefty family attendance, and the higher ratio for short, dry events.
  • Add 1 ADA easily accessible device for each 10 basic devices, with a minimum of one available unit per distinctive cluster of areas or concessions area.
  • Place one handwashing station for each 4 to 6 toilets, and think about standalone sanitizer towers at field entryways during high-traffic hours.
  • For occasions lasting greater than 8 hours in a single day, or running 2 or even more days, routine a minimum of one mid-event solution, more if high warm, rain, or giving ins grease is likely.
  • If any type of area case has more than a 2 min stroll to the nearby financial institution of bathrooms, develop a satellite collection of 2 to 4 units nearby to shorten lines and lower pressure on major banks.

These proportions are starting points. They work due to the fact that they blend expected dwell time, sex equilibrium, and the truth that individuals make use of the closest facility. Linkon Logs team commonly refine the matters after strolling the grounds and reviewing timetables. A straightforward modification, like splitting a 10 unit financial institution into two 5 system count on either side of giving ins, can cut perceived wait times also if the overall matter remains the same.

Placement that lowers lines and complaints

Place toilets where feet already go. That indicates near concessions, between car parking and the areas, and along primary walkways that cause referee tents or admin tables. Maintain them visible adequate to discourage vandalism, but not so main that they obstruct group circulation. An L shaped bank that puts behind a vendor tent often works well, due to the fact that it lets you divided the lines and include a handwash terminal in the space. When room allows, angle financial institutions so individuals do not queue into traffic.

Lighting is worthy of focus. If video games run to dusk or if honors events follow the last, placement systems where existing light posts or portable lights towers can reach. It improves safety and makes cleansing much easier if a late solution is prepared. If you set systems on yard, cut that area in advance. Waist-high weeds turn every journey right into a complaint.

Noise matters also. Fans do not want the door thud interrupting vital plays. Keep restrooms a minimum of 50 to 75 feet from the fence line behind home base or along soccer sidelines. That range additionally deters ball strikes. A solitary foul round can dent a door and sour the mood.

A brief case instance from a Sarpy Area weekend

A spring football festival near Papillion drew about 120 teams, with top presence near 3,500 on Saturday afternoon. The first plan required 28 conventional units, 3 ADA units, and 8 handwash stations, split amongst 3 field sheaths and a main supplier plaza. Weather was light in the early morning, after that jumped to 88 degrees with strong sun.

By noontime, lines near the plaza stretched to 10 individuals. Families were staying longer between video games, and the cut ice stand had a 20 min delay. The website lead called Linkon Logs. A neighboring staff ending up in Pottawattamie Region drew 2 extra handwash terminals and 4 standard units from stock and provided at 2:30 p.m., after that performed a partial solution on the central bank. The director also repositioned two systems from a quieter area capsule closer to the enroller row. Lines dropped under five people within the hour.

Sunday remained active yet smoother. The takeaway was not that the original matter was incorrect. It was that family dwell time and concessions task shift use, often significantly. The ability to bend the plan mattered as high as the plan itself.

Weather, anchoring, and safety

Nebraska wind has point of views, and tornados can roll via quick. Requirement devices deal with wind well when leveled and anchored, but positioning issues. Prevent ridgelines and open corners that funnel gusts. If you should position a long row in a subjected location, stagger the devices a little as opposed to straightening them in an ideal line. That separates the wind. Stakes and straps add insurance, and rubber mats under the front lip minimize rocking on soft ground.

Heat calls for color whenever possible. Under a line of trees is great if the cover is high enough to prevent sap drips. Near a structure, leave space for egress and ADA course of travel. For lightning, comply with the place's security protocol. While mobile toilets are not lightning shelters, maintaining them away from high, isolated posts is prudent.

At night, illumination and sightlines are safety and security attributes. Position banks accessible of portable light towers and away from blind edges. Vandalism goes down when staff and families can see the location in passing.

What a site stroll with a knowledgeable vendor looks like

An efficient stroll takes an hour, in some cases less. Start at the main entrance. Map the flow: where individuals park, where they gather, just how they relocate. Determine shade, water, and power factors. Mark likely restroom banks at giving ins, between field hulls, and near HQ. Examine the quality and firmness of each pad. Keep in mind wind exposure and strategy anchor factors. Choose where handwash stations go about food lines so individuals can march and rejoin without crossing traffic.

Next, review timetables. When do the largest age play, and on which areas. If the U9 women brace peaks at noontime on Fields 2 to 4, include capacity there during that home window. If the beer yard opens at 3, anticipate a late afternoon rise. Agree on service windows that fit halftime breaks or game gaps.

Finally, set backups. Where can extra devices land if required. Where should a solution truck phase if roads are obstructed. Who holds the trick for the back gate. File it with an easy map and share it with your staff and the supplier group. When the day gets active, that strategy keeps every person aligned.
